While the West has come closer together in the first year of the Ukraine war, they have grown further apart from the rest of the world. A new study by the European Council on Foreign Relations (ECFR), Europe’s leading think tank, reveals just that. The study was released ahead of the one-year anniversary of the war in Ukraine.

For their study, ECFR researchers surveyed people in nine European Union (EU) member states, as well as the US, UK, India, China, Russia and Turkey. This reveals a huge gap between the general opinion of the people of the European Union and that of the rest of the world on matters of war, democracy and the balance of power in the world. EU member states surveyed include France, Germany and Poland.

The researchers involved in the investigation concluded that the Ukraine war could be a major turning point in world history. After this, a “world free from Western influence” can now emerge. Mark Leonard, director of the ECFR and one of the study’s authors, told the Guardian – “The war in Ukraine revealed a paradox. The West is now more united, but its influence in the world is greater than ever Small any time.

Professor Timothy Garton-Ash of the University of Oxford, UK, who participated in the study, described the results of the study as throwing cold water on Western enthusiasm. He said – the war in Ukraine created unity between Europe and the United States and gave them a common purpose. But Western countries have completely failed to bring China, India, Turkey and other world powers over. He said – “The lesson is clear. We must immediately prepare such a new narrative, which can be accepted in the world’s largest democracy, India, and countries like it.

During the survey, respondents were given ten words to describe Russia’s behaviour. In the U.S., 45 percent chose the word “aggressive,” while 41 percent chose the word “untrustworthy.” In Europe, these words were chosen by 48% and 30%, respectively, while in the UK, the figures were 57% and 49%. But in non-Western countries, the numbers are still much smaller.

Instead, majorities in these countries believe that the dominance of the United States and its partners will end in the next decade. An expert involved in the study told the Guardian that most people in the world now believe that the world is divided into two poles. People outside of western countries see things differently now.

He said – “Western countries must now learn to live with hostile countries with authoritarian systems, such as China and Russia. At the same time, they will have to learn to live with independent countries such as India and Turkey. These countries do not form any third group , and there is no common ideology. But they are not prepared to comply with the wishes and plans of major powers.
